So i messed around in bodyslide, trying to create a new preset until i stumbled upon an outfit by Nisetanaka (Dovakini) of which a chap made a 3ba conversion of it. I scroll to see the morphs into the outfit studio, and i see a lot of new sliders, some of which i would like to get on other outfits. I noticed that i can use (in-game) morph altering mods, such as milkmod+morpheditor, to add or remove them as will, and that the racemenu saves of the character are keeping all the changed done via those mods. Handy enough, but those changes only affect that one particular outfit. And as a mod addict, i of course needed more. So here is my question: Being a not particularely bright person at messing around with the files of the game without absolutely breaking it beyond belief, wondering why on earth have i touched my finally (Somewhat) stable build and holding back tears as i try to reverse engineer my absolute lack of competence on the matter, i wondered if i could delete the armor parts of the outfit and just keep the body as some sort of reference to add those sliders to my existing outfits, maybe as a conversion reference or something. Considering the bodyshape is the exact same as the basic 3BA bodyshape, could i just replace the current body with this one as a reference, copy and conform it and it may do the trick ? If so, making it a template reference would probably be my best bet, but i have absolutely no clue as to how you can do that from anything i can produce from bodyslide and outfit studio. My many thanks to the loverslab wizards out there who probably suffered many minor strokes trying to comprehend what i mean. I'm trying my best. It should be fairly simple. In outfit studio, open the outfit you want to add sliders to, load the body you like as a reference, and conform the new sliders.
